Trip Overview

This 70.1-mile drive from Amelia to Baton Rouge, Louisiana, is a straightforward trip that can easily be completed in about 1 hour and 46 minutes. Designed as a single-day excursion, it's a practical option for getting between these two points in the Southeast region. You'll encounter an estimated fuel cost of $11 for this journey. The route primarily utilizes Highway 1 and LA 70, giving it a highway-focused feel. With no designated stops in the data, this trip offers flexibility for spontaneous breaks along the way.

Drive Character

Expect a largely highway-focused experience on this 70.1-mile journey, with 66% of the drive taking place on main roads like Highway 1 and LA 70. The longest uninterrupted stretch you'll encounter is 20.4 miles on Highway 1. While the data suggests a direct route, keep in mind that a significant portion is on established highways, offering a consistent driving pace. The road's character is defined by these main arteries, guiding you efficiently toward Baton Rouge.

Most of the miles stay on highways, which makes pacing and fuel planning easier than turn-by-turn city driving.
There are about 21 navigation steps in the underlying route data, so the final approach matters more than the middle miles.
Highway 1 is the longest continuous segment at about 20.4 miles.

Turn-by-Turn Driving Directions

Step-by-step road directions between Amelia, LA and Baton Rouge, LA.

1

Start on PR 35

0.4 mi · 1 min · Lake Palourde Road
2

Turn left

0.8 mi · 2 min
3

Merge onto US 90

5.6 mi · 6 min · US 90
4

Take the exit

0.3 mi · 37 sec
5

Turn right onto LA 70

0.4 mi · 34 sec · 9th Street
6

At end of road, turn right onto LA 70

16 mi · 23 min · Marguerite Street
Use the straight lane.
7

Turn right onto LA 70

12 mi · 18 min · LA 70
8

Turn left onto LA 69

8.7 mi · 15 min · State Route 69
9

Continue on LA 69

2.6 mi · 4 min · Bowie Street
10

Turn left onto LA 1

9.1 mi · 10 min · Highway 1
11

Continue on LA 1

1.0 mi · 2 min · Church Street
12

Continue on LA 1

11 mi · 17 min · Highway 1
13

Take the exit

0.5 mi · 58 sec
Toward I 10 East: Baton Rouge
14

Merge onto I 10

0.9 mi · 1 min · Horace Wilkinson Bridge
15

Take the exit

0.4 mi · 48 sec
Exit 155A Toward LA 30 Use the straight / slight right lanes.
16

Keep slight right at fork

399 ft · 9 sec
Use the slight right lane.
17

Turn straight onto LA 3290-1

494 ft · 18 sec · Oklahoma Street
18

Turn right onto LA 30

0.3 mi · 34 sec · Nicholson Drive
19

Continue on Saint Louis Street

0.3 mi · 45 sec · Saint Louis Street
20

Turn right onto Government Street

13 ft · 0 sec · Government Street
21

Arrive at destination

Government Street
